VACUUM SEALING
Button
Usage
SPEED
Using this button, you can toggle between 2 different speed settings: NORMAL and
GENTLE. An LED will indicate the currently set speed.
FOOD
Press this button to select the type of food or object, you wish to vacuum seal: MOIST
food containing a lot of liquid, or DRY food or objects.
VAC/
MARINATE
For your convenience, this button is located at the right side of the appliance. Use it for
starting the sealing of containers or for marinating, with the vacuum hose connected to
the vacuum outlet of the appliance.
Shortly press the button to start sealing of a vacuum container.
Press the button for some seconds to start the marinating process (see: ‘Marinating’).
STOP
You may cancel any sealing or vacuuming process at any time you wish by pressing the
STOP button. The appliance will immediately stop operation and ventilate the vacuum
chamber or container.
TIP: If you wish to terminate sealing but seal the bag with the low pressure already achie-
ved, press the SEAL button.

MARINATING
Vacuum containers are perfectly suited for marinating foods in a short time. This is
because the micro-holes of the foods are opened under low pressure, allowing pickle
infusion very quickly. Using this function, the appliance will run cycles of vacuuming
and ventilating the container. This way, foods will get optimum marinade infusion in
the least time duration. The designated vacuum tube is essential for using this func-
tion. Additionally, there should be a manually adjustable pressure valve on the con-
tainer lid.
Note:
To prevent germs from getting into your food, it is good advice to sterilize the con-
tainer and container lid before filling in food.
